The unit is designed only for DC 12V negative ground operation system. Make sure your vehicle is
connected to DC 12V negative ground operation system. Be sure to connect the speaker(-) leads
to the speaker(-) terminal. Never connect the left and right channel speaker wires together or to the
vehicle body.
The normal temperature for operation is between -20 and +60 degree Celsius. Do not work in
extreme high or low temperature and lock vents or radiator panels of the unit, blocking them will
cause heat to build up inside the unit and may cause damage or fire.
This unit can play the following discs (12 cm) and media files: DVD±R/RW / RMVB / 1080p / MPEG
4 / DivX / AVI / SVCD / VCD / MP3 / WMA / CD-R/RW / JPEG.

Radio Mode
Press repeatedly to fine tune the radio frequency upward or downward. Press
& hold shortly to tune the radio frequency to the upward or downward station
for broadcasting.
Disc / USB / SD Input Mode / Bluetooth Mode
Press repeatedly to shift track upward or downward for playback.
Each time press & hold shortly to activate various fast forward or fast rewind
speeds fort playback (Note: Fast forward or fast rewind is not available at
Bluetooth mode).
TV Mode
Press to shift to upward or downward channel for broadcasting.
Press & hold shortly to tune frequency and stop for broadcasting when a
channel received.

7. 1 – 6 Radio Mode
Press any one of the number key 1-6 to select a station that had been
stored in the preset memory number key 1-6 for broadcasting.
0 – 9 Disc / USB / SD / Input Mode
Press directly to input the number of track for playback.
Bluetooth Mode
Press directly to input the phone number for dial out.
TV Mode
Press directly to input the channel number for broadcasting
8. ZOOM Disc / USB / SD Input Mode
At video & photo playback, each time press & hold shortly to select various
zoom in and zoom out of screen for viewing.
Radio Mode
Press to start scanning all the preset stations on memory and stop for a
few seconds for broadcasting.
Press & hold shortly to start searching the frequency and storing the
strongest signal stations into the preset memory stations number 1-6. After
storing the stations, the unit starts scanning all the preset stations on
memory and stop for a few seconds for broadcasting.
9. BND Radio Mode
Press repeatedly to select the desired radio band for broadcasting.
Disc / USB / SD Input Mode
At playback mode, press to stop playback and shift to playlist for playback
selection (depended on the input device, playlist may not be available).
Note: Not available for control at music playback mode
Bluetooth Mode
Press to hang up or refuse an incoming call.
